Why Google's Been Fined $162 Million In India: 5 Reasons
Google has been fined Rs 1,338 by India's anti-trust watchdog for allegedly abusing its commanding position in the local smartphone market. Google said the move was "a major setback for Indian...
What's Your Reaction?